“ Affordable, clean, and delicious buffet. Mask are required when grabbing food and they give you gloves to use (optional). They have 4 main rows of food, with 2 side sections of desserts. In each corner there are America /Asian soups (clam chowder, hot & sour soup, sago in coconut milk dessert etc). They have fresh sashimi/sushi/raw oysters selection. There's a variety of take-out Chinese dishes, dim sum, authentic Chinese dishes, and American food. My favorite were the bubble tea drinks (milk tea, taro, mango, strawberry flavors etc flavors with pearls). There's a ice cream/soda/coffee machine. Went here for lunch and the food selection was plentiful. Staff are attentive in taking away your used plates. Visa/mastercard/cash accepted. There's a to-go option that's priced by the pound, this was very popular when I was eating there. 1.5 hour time limit. ”

It has been a while that I haven't come to this buffet restaurant. They have a large parking area at the back. I went with my son, this place still offers food to go, you pay foods per pound. The restaurant keeps the place very clean, they provide costumers disposable hand gloves for when getting food at the buffet, they require people to put on a mask at the buffet area. Booths are separated by rigid plastics as a Covid precaution. The process on getting food to go here per pound is: get food containers and gloves from the cashier, then go to the buffet area, fill up your containers with the foods the you like, (we opted for walnut shrimps, Chinese broccoli, spring rolls, lo mien and a few fried plantains) when you are done just go to the cashier and pay. Prices are reasonable. Food quality are terrific for the ones that we chose. Their Lunch buffet is very affordable from Monday to Friday, tons of choices, they even have sushi ( I don't know if this is offered during lunch) at the far end of the buffet area.
